The ASHRAE stands for the American Society of Heating,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Engineers an organization that sets standards for energy efficiency in buildings. R-value - The measurement of the resistance to heat transfer or flow, higher numbers indicate greater insulation value. U-factor - The reciprocal of R-value, used in the construction industry to describe a window's thermal efficiency.

Spectrumly-selective glass - A tinted glass that allows specific wavelengths of energy to enter the building while absorbing other wavelengths. It is designed to let in high levels of daylight, visible light and reduce infrared short-wave and longer-wave radiation.

R-value A measure of the resistance to heat transfer. The higher the number, the greater the insulating value of a door or window. The R-value is the reciprocal to its U-factor.

Mullion - A part used to structurally join two window or door units. It could be constructed of aluminum, wood or any other material. It can be hollow or solid, but it must be strong enough to withstand the weight of the window operating.

Awning - Window that has a sash which is able to swing out from the bottom. It is a single or double hanging.

Swing door - Windsor's word for all swing door options, which include bi-hinge, singles and a center hinge one, two and three panel options.

Box bay - A combination of windows that extend to the outside. It is comprised of a larger center window and two smaller flanking units.

Sash - The vertical or horizontal members that hold the glass in the door, window or other structure. It is typically operated by the chain or rope known as the sash cord.

Insulation

One of the most effective methods to cut down on your consumption of energy and save money on utility bills is to insulate your home. Insulation hinders the flow of heat that is conductive and stops radiant heat from entering and leaving a room. It is measured by an R-value, which demonstrates how efficiently the material slows the flow of heat through conductive surfaces and decreases radiant transfer. Insulation can be installed in a variety of building materials like wood, low-maintenance vinyl and fiberglass, and is available in various thicknesses.
